Development
Makoto is present in the original proposal for a hypothetical Codename: Sailor V anime, but her name is given as Mamoru Chino. Creator Naoko Takeuchi confirms that this character eventually became Makoto, and writes that the original concept was quite different—Makoto was not only tough, but in fact was meant to be the leader of a female gang as well as a smoker. A very similar name was later given to the series' male protagonist, Mamoru Chiba.
Sailor Jupiter's original costume design, like the others', was fully unique. It featured buckles, very long gloves, blue and yellow highlights, a bare lower torso, and a profusion of thin, dark pink ribbons—along with a face-plate and communicator. Later, Takeuchi was surprised by these sketches and stated that she did not remember drawing them. Her instructions to the animators included a note that Makoto should appear muscular, "a little meatier than normal."
The kanji of Makoto's surname translate as "tree" or "wood" or "spirit" (木, ki?) and "field" or "civilian" (野, no?). Her given name is in hiragana makoto (まこと?) and therefore difficult to translate. Possible meanings include "truth," "wisdom," and "sincerity." The given name "Makoto" is usually a male name, but is sometimes given to girls; its use here highlights Makoto's tomboyishness.
